[PATCH 044/128] KVM: selftests: Convert xss_msr_test away from VCPU_ID

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Convert xss_msr_test to use vm_create_with_one_vcpu() and pass around a
'struct kvm_vcpu' object instead of using a global VCPU_ID.  Note, this
is a "functional" change in the sense that the test now creates a vCPU
with vcpu_id==0 instead of vcpu_id==1.  The non-zero VCPU_ID was 100%
arbitrary and added little to no validation coverage.  If testing
non-zero vCPU IDs is desirable for generic tests, that can be done in the
future by tweaking the VM creation helpers.
